¿Qué es lo que más te gusta de Mezmo?
Muy fácil de implementar.
Define el nombre de la aplicación y el entorno.
La aplicación es genial. Compacta, buena interfaz de usuario. Los registros son fáciles de leer. Diferente color para advertencias/errores. Visualización de picos.
Configura alertas, incluidas alertas cuando ciertos registros aumentan en frecuencia. Muchas opciones excelentes en la aplicación.
La aplicación facilita ver solo ciertos tipos de registros, de ciertos servidores/aplicaciones/tiempos. ¡Incluso buscar en los registros!
Cantidad generosa de retención de datos por dólar, y número ilimitado de hosts. El cargo mínimo es de $10/mes.
Mezmo no ofrece ningún servicio aparte del registro. Otras soluciones de registro en la nube ofrecen todo tipo de monitoreo de rendimiento. Pero para mí, esto es en realidad un beneficio. Hace que la aplicación sea muy simple y fácil de usar y el SDK muy simple de configurar. Las herramientas más complejas a menudo son demasiado engorrosas e incómodas porque hacen demasiado. Haz una cosa y hazla bien. Reseña recopilada por y alojada en G2.com.
¿Qué es lo que no te gusta de Mezmo?
* No es posible enviar el nivel regular "log". Tienes que elegir entre "debug", "trace", "info", "warn" o "error". Al intentar registrar {level: "log"} en NodeJS, obtengo un error. El SDK simplemente no lo permite. Así que, es molesto cuando registro el nivel regular "console.log", tengo que enviarlo como {level: "trace"} en su lugar. No es un gran problema para mí, porque no uso trace.
* Sería bueno si debug/trace/info fueran de diferentes colores en la aplicación. Actualmente, todos son grises.
* No sé si lo han arreglado o no, pero a partir de enero de 2021, había una limitación... Si haces un registro con menos frecuencia que una vez por minuto, entonces su servicio de registro parece entrar en modo de suspensión. Luego, si no has enviado un registro en un tiempo, simplemente dejaría caer el primer registro, no lo reportaría en absoluto. Esto fue frustrante. Lo solucioné con un "setInterval" en mi servidor, enviando un registro "debug" una vez cada minuto. De esta manera, incluso si envío eventos de registro ocasionales y raros desde diferentes servidores, todos los registros ahora aparecen sin perderse. Es bastante fácil. Sin embargo, para no contaminar el panel de la aplicación, tuve que reservar el nivel "debug" para este propósito, y nunca usarlo en mi aplicación real. Luego filtrarlo de la aplicación.
Así que ahora, puedo usar (y ver en el panel) "info", "warn", "error", y en lugar de "log" tengo que usar "trace". Estos son los únicos niveles disponibles que realmente funcionan.
Afortunadamente, para mí eso es suficiente. Y, la interfaz de usuario es muy buena, y el precio es muy bueno para lo bien que funciona todo. Pero si el servicio fuera menos amigable para el usuario, o el precio más alto, mi calificación sería más baja. Así que en general, ¡gran trabajo!
* La documentación no está bien redactada, no es fácil de navegar. La documentación menciona un nivel de registro "fatal", pero eso en realidad no funciona. Reseña recopilada por y alojada en G2.com.